Mosaic is an AMM DEX and swap aggregator on Movement that routes trades across its own Movement liquidity through its own constant-product and StableSwap pools and other venues. The Mosaic AMM record covers the native pools, not the router service: LPs supply paired inventory, receive fees and may stake LP tokens for emissions. That market-making exposure makes the version-1 amm-lp dossier dispositive. The 2026-08-15 survey showed only about $3,685 of native-pool TVL, a lifecycle observation rather than the deciding rule.

Mechanism applicability

Mosaic documents two native AMM designs on Movement: Uniswap-v2-style constant-product pools for uncorrelated pairs and Curve-like StableSwap pools for correlated assets. LPs supply the reserves used for swaps and may stake their LP tokens in farming contracts. Both designs remain market-making inventory and directly fit the shared amm-lp dossier.

Current observation and perimeter

Observed 2026-08-15: the official site and documentation continued to present Mosaic as a Movement-native DEX aggregator and liquidity protocol. DefiLlama reported approximately $3,685 in Mosaic AMM TVL, entirely on Movement. This record is limited to Mosaic’s native pools; routed third-party liquidity belongs to those underlying venues, not Mosaic AMM TVL.

Control, loss and exit applicability

LPs can supply or withdraw through self-custodied on-chain contracts, but swap flow and arbitrage determine the asset mix and value returned. StableSwap reduces slippage for correlated pairs but does not remove depeg or divergence loss. Farming rewards are claimable without a stated lockup, yet emissions cannot restore lost relative inventory or guarantee a proposed-size exit from the very small observed pool base.

Why the class rule decides

Aggregation can improve a trader’s execution but does not change the economics of the Mosaic LPs whose capital fills native-pool routes. Constant-product and StableSwap curves both sell relative inventory into price movement. The shared version-1 amm-lp dossier therefore controls before Movement-chain or code review. Reopen only for a separate product whose client return does not require AMM market-making exposure.
